South Africa's position as Africa's most developed economy, combined with Johannesburg's financial leadership and Cape Town's emerging tech scene, creates unique opportunities for AI automation. From the JSE in Sandton to the Silicon Cape startup ecosystem, South African businesses are leveraging AI to drive innovation across mining, finance, telecommunications, and agriculture while serving as the gateway to the broader African continent.
🏛️ South Africa's Economic Leadership
South Africa represents 24% of Africa's GDP and hosts the continent's most sophisticated financial markets, telecommunications infrastructure, and technology ecosystem. The country's advanced regulatory framework, skilled workforce, and established business networks make it the ideal launchpad for AI-powered expansion across Africa.

💰 Financial Services & Banking AI
Digital Banking Innovation
South African banks lead Africa in digital transformation and AI adoption:
- Mobile Banking: AI-powered banking apps serving unbanked populations
- Credit Scoring: Alternative data models for financial inclusion
- Fraud Prevention: AI detecting sophisticated financial crimes and cyberthreats
- Cross-Border Payments: AI optimizing remittances across African markets
Insurance & Risk Management
South Africa's insurance sector embraces AI for competitive advantage:
- Actuarial Modeling: AI improving risk assessment and pricing accuracy
- Claims Processing: Automated claims assessment and fraud detection
- Microinsurance: AI enabling affordable insurance for low-income populations
- Agricultural Insurance: Satellite data and AI for crop insurance and weather derivatives
⛏️ Mining & Natural Resources AI
Mining Industry Innovation
South Africa's mining sector, including companies like Anglo American and Sasol, leads in industrial AI:
- Predictive Maintenance: AI preventing equipment failures in harsh mining environments
- Safety Monitoring: AI-powered worker safety and hazard detection systems
- Resource Optimization: AI maximizing ore extraction and processing efficiency
- Environmental Monitoring: AI tracking environmental impact and compliance
Energy & Utilities
South Africa's energy sector transformation through AI:
- Load Shedding Optimization: AI managing power grid stability and outage scheduling
- Renewable Energy: AI optimizing solar and wind power generation
- Smart Grids: AI-powered electricity distribution and demand management
- Water Management: AI optimizing water distribution in drought-prone regions
🌾 Agriculture & Food Security
Precision Agriculture
South Africa's agricultural sector leverages AI for food security and export competitiveness:
- Crop Monitoring: Satellite imagery and AI for crop health assessment
- Weather Prediction: AI-powered weather forecasting for farming decisions
- Irrigation Optimization: AI managing water usage in water-scarce regions
- Pest Management: AI identifying and predicting pest outbreaks
Supply Chain & Food Processing
AI optimizing South Africa's agricultural value chain:
- Quality Control: AI-powered food safety and quality assessment
- Logistics Optimization: AI managing cold chain and transportation
- Market Intelligence: AI predicting commodity prices and market demand
- Traceability: Blockchain and AI for food origin tracking and certification
📱 Telecommunications & Digital Infrastructure
Mobile Network Optimization
South Africa's telecom giants like MTN and Vodacom drive connectivity AI:
- Network Optimization: AI managing network capacity and quality of service
- Predictive Maintenance: AI preventing network outages and equipment failures
- Customer Experience: AI-powered customer service and technical support
- 5G Deployment: AI optimizing next-generation network rollout
Digital Inclusion
AI enabling digital access across South Africa's diverse population:
- Language Processing: AI supporting 11 official languages and local dialects
- Affordable Connectivity: AI optimizing network costs for low-income users
- Digital Literacy: AI-powered education and skill development platforms
- Financial Inclusion: AI enabling mobile money and digital payments
